Adding Numbers to Text in Microsoft Word
Microsoft Word offers several intuitive ways to incorporate numbers into your text. Here are a few common techniques:
1. Using the Numbered List Feature:
This is the easiest method for creating numbered lists.
- Steps:
- Select the text you want to number.
- Go to the "Home" tab on the ribbon.
- Click the numbered list button (it usually looks like "1, 2, 3").
- Word automatically applies a numbered list format. You can customize the numbering style (e.g., A, B, C; i, ii, iii) from the dropdown menu.
2. Manually Typing Numbers:
For simple additions or integrating numbers within sentences, manually typing is perfectly acceptable.
- Steps: Simply type the number directly into your text where you need it. For example, "There are 3 apples." Ensure consistent spacing to maintain readability.

Adding Numbers to Text in Google Docs
Google Docs provides similar functionalities for adding numbers to text.
1. Numbered Lists:
- Steps: Similar to Word, select your text, go to the "Format" menu, select "Numbered list," and choose your preferred style.
2. Manual Input:
As with Word, simply type the numbers directly into your text.
3. Using Equations (for complex scenarios):
For complex numerical sequences or equations within the text, use the "Insert" menu > "Equation" to create and format your numerical elements.
Tips for Effective Number Integration
- Consistency: Maintain a consistent numbering style and format throughout your document.
- Readability: Ensure sufficient spacing between numbers and text to improve readability. Avoid cramming numbers together.
- Context: Always provide enough context to explain the meaning and significance of the numbers you're using.
- Formatting: Use appropriate formatting (bolding, italics, etc.) to emphasize numbers as needed.
